Contact
Reach out for compassionate support today.
(317)527-4756
Location
Business mailing address
Address
Haven and Horizon LLC
6101 North Keystone
Ste.100 #1467
Indianapolis , IN 46220
Contact
Get in touch
Haven and Horizon LLC | Beech Grove, IN | Telehealth Services Across Indiana
Phone
Torraine@havenandhorizontherapy.com
(317) 527-4756
© 2025. All rights reserved.
